test

  • 在 2017 年学习 React + Redux 的一些建议(下篇)

    作者:郭永峰,用友网络公共前端团队负责人
    本次系列文章分为上中下三篇,《在 2017 年学习 React + Redux 的一些建议(上篇)》 和 《在 2017 年学习 React + Redux 的一些建议(中篇)》 可点击阅读。
    原创文章,版权所有,转载请注明出处。

    关于测试的一些学习建议

    我们可以组合使用一些测试工具来帮助测试 JS 代码,一般使用 Mocha/Chai 或是 Karma/Jasmine 。而如果当你想测试 angular 的代码时,你会发现还有更多的测试工具。不过对于 React 应用的测试,

  • 最近一周在补前人留下的测试用例,然后碰到了一个 sinon 的使用问题困扰了一整天,特做此记录。

    文章的前提是:你对 sinon 已经有了初步的使用经验。

    // src.js
    function add(a, b) {
      return a + b;
    }
    
    function multiplication(a, b) {
      return a * b;
    }
    
    export function complex(a, b) {
      console.error('此处为 error 发生出');
      return add(a, b) + multiplication(a, b);
    }
    
    export